## Formula sandbox tuning

User-supplied formulas in Gridmoor execute inside a restricted interpreter with hard ceilings on time, memory, and call depth. Reviewers should confirm any change to these ceilings is justified in the PR description, since raising them widens the abuse surface. Defaults were chosen from production traces. The current limits are as follows.

limits module of tafog-fawip:
WEIGHTS = {
    "julix": 57,
    "lamys": 992,
    "kasvan": 209,
    "quenok": 750,
    "alddor": 259,
    "oliath": 1009,
    "wenix": 815,
}

## Deployment

LiftSim deploys to the Orvane batch cluster nightly. One binary, one config file. Simulation runs are queued by the dispatcher-eval job; results land in the shared results bucket by 0600. Known issue: runs over 40 floors still OOM on small workers — use the large pool. No schema changes this week. Rollback is just redeploying last night's tag. Please review before Thursday's sync. Current deployment configuration is shown below.

deployment values, yahag-tawef:
ZORWYN_HOST=zorwyn.tolvaqlabs.internal
ZORWYN_PORT=9300

**Item 9 — GPU memory profiler sign-off.** Run the Fathomlens profiler against the standard Orrick workload suite and confirm peak allocation stays under the documented ceiling for all three supported card tiers. Archive the flame reports with the release bundle so future maintainers can compare regressions release-over-release. Sign-off is complete once the archived report references the build token recorded below.

session token of tajog-fahaf = htk21_4ae55819f45410afcb307